Connecting via QR code on iPhone
The most modern and secure way to share network access without saying the password out loud is to use QR code. Camera iPhone It has a built-in scanner that recognizes special tags containing network information. The router's owner or someone already connected to the network can generate such a code and show you their smartphone screen.
The connection process takes just seconds. Simply unlock your iPhone and point the camera at the code image. The system will automatically recognize the data type and display a network connection notification. Wi-FiBy clicking the notification, you confirm the action, and the phone will automatically enter all the necessary encryption keys. This method works on all devices with iOS 11 and newer.
It's important that the QR code is generated correctly. The standard format for generating a string is as follows:
WIFI:T:WPA;S:Network_Name;P:Network_Password;H:false;;
Where T indicates the type of security, S — network name (SSID), and P — the password itself. If even one character in the code is incorrect, the connection will fail. Many routers, such as Keenetic or MikroTik, allow you to generate such code directly in the administrator's web interface.

Why is WPS considered vulnerable?
The WPS protocol uses an 8-digit PIN code, which can theoretically be brute-forced in a few hours, unlike the complex WPA2 passwords, which would take years to brute-force.
Risks of using open and third-party networks
The desire to connect to Wi-Fi without a password often leads users to open, unencrypted networks. On such networks (Open Wi-Fi) all transmitted traffic is visible to any network participant with the appropriate software. Attackers can use packet sniffers to intercept logins, passwords, and personal correspondence.
Even if the connection is successful, you should not conduct financial transactions or enter bank card details. Protocol HTTP (unprotected) transmits data in clear text. Only the presence of HTTPS provides encryption between the browser and the website, but does not hide the fact that you are visiting the resource from the access point owner. VPN In such cases, it is a mandatory requirement of digital hygiene.
There's also the risk of connecting to a "duplicate" network. Hackers can create an access point with a name identical to a popular brand (for example, "Starbucks_WiFi" or "Airport_Free") and wait for the victim to connect automatically. Once connected to such a network, your device could become a target for man-in-the-middle attacks.

What to do if iPhone doesn't connect automatically?
Try forgetting the network. To do this, go to Settings → Wi-Fi, click on the icon (i) next to the network name and select Forget this networkThen try connecting again by entering the password manually or scanning the QR code.
